Playing Golf
- Improved hand-eye coordination by aiming and hitting the golf ball towards the target.
- Developed focus and concentration while strategizing shots and adjusting to different course conditions.
- Enhanced physical fitness through the repetitive swinging motion and walking between holes.
- Learned about sportsmanship and etiquette by adhering to rules, respecting other players, and acknowledging successes and failures.
Tips
Engaging in golf can provide a well-rounded learning experience that combines physical activity with mental focus and strategic thinking. To further explore and enhance skills in playing golf, consider focusing on refining specific techniques such as putting or driving, participating in structured training sessions or lessons, competing in tournaments to test skills under pressure, and studying the mental aspect of the game to improve focus and decision-making on the course.
Book Recommendations
- Ben Hogan's Five Lessons: The Modern Fundamentals of Golf by Ben Hogan: A classic instructional book providing timeless tips and techniques for mastering the fundamentals of golf, including grip, stance, posture, and swing mechanics.
- Golf is Not a Game of Perfect by Dr. Bob Rotella: Dr. Rotella shares insights on the mental game of golf, emphasizing the importance of attitude, visualization, and handling pressure to improve performance on the course.
- Harvey Penick's Little Red Book: Lessons and Teachings from a Lifetime in Golf by Harvey Penick: A compilation of wisdom and anecdotes from renowned golf instructor Harvey Penick, offering valuable lessons on technique, strategy, and the mental aspects of golf.
